German MCM Orange and Brown Striped Cachepot or Planter winder and very sturdily attachedThis is a super sharp looking Wilhelm Kagel West German small planter or cachepot, c. 1950s 60s, incised with the WK mark on the underside. I find the combination of the form and surface decoration just perfect, and think it would be great filled with anything from a narcissus to an orchid to something leafy green.
